La mayor\u00eda de los electrodom\u00e9sticos utilizan corriente alterna (CA), mientras que la energ\u00eda solar produce corriente continua (CC). Por lo tanto, los inversores ayudan a aprovechar mejor la energ\u00eda. Existen dos tipos principales de inversores: los de onda sinusoidal pura y los de onda sinusoidal modificada.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Hoy compararemos el inversor de onda sinusoidal pura con el inversor de onda sinusoidal modificada y analizaremos las diferencias entre ambos.<\/span><\/p>\n<p>&nbsp;<\/p>\n<h2><span style=\"font-weight: 400;\">\u00bfQu\u00e9 es un inversor?<\/span><\/h2>\n<p><img loading=\"lazy\" decoding=\"async\" class=\"alignnone  wp-image-20028\" src=\"https:\/\/luxpowertek.com\/wp-content\/uploads\/2026\/08\/hybrid-inverters-for-solar-single-phase-for-Industry-and-commerce-GENPRO-LB-EU8-12K-300x300.webp\" alt=\"Inversores h\u00edbridos para energ\u00eda solar monof\u00e1sica para la industria y el comercio - GENPRO-LB-EU8-12K\" width=\"472\" height=\"472\" srcset=\"https:\/\/luxpowertek.com\/wp-content\/uploads\/2026\/08\/hybrid-inverters-for-solar-single-phase-for-Industry-and-commerce-GENPRO-LB-EU8-12K-300x300.webp 300w, https:\/\/luxpowertek.com\/wp-content\/uploads\/2026\/08\/hybrid-inverters-for-solar-single-phase-for-Industry-and-commerce-GENPRO-LB-EU8-12K-1030x1030.webp 1030w, https:\/\/luxpowertek.com\/wp-content\/uploads\/2026\/08\/hybrid-inverters-for-solar-single-phase-for-Industry-and-commerce-GENPRO-LB-EU8-12K-80x80.webp 80w, https:\/\/luxpowertek.com\/wp-content\/uploads\/2026\/08\/hybrid-inverters-for-solar-single-phase-for-Industry-and-commerce-GENPRO-LB-EU8-12K-768x768.webp 768w, https:\/\/luxpowertek.com\/wp-content\/uploads\/2026\/08\/hybrid-inverters-for-solar-single-phase-for-Industry-and-commerce-GENPRO-LB-EU8-12K-1536x1536.webp 1536w, https:\/\/luxpowertek.com\/wp-content\/uploads\/2026\/08\/hybrid-inverters-for-solar-single-phase-for-Industry-and-commerce-GENPRO-LB-EU8-12K-2048x2048.webp 2048w, https:\/\/luxpowertek.com\/wp-content\/uploads\/2026\/08\/hybrid-inverters-for-solar-single-phase-for-Industry-and-commerce-GENPRO-LB-EU8-12K-12x12.webp 12w, https:\/\/luxpowertek.com\/wp-content\/uploads\/2026\/08\/hybrid-inverters-for-solar-single-phase-for-Industry-and-commerce-GENPRO-LB-EU8-12K-510x510.webp 510w, https:\/\/luxpowertek.com\/wp-content\/uploads\/2026\/08\/hybrid-inverters-for-solar-single-phase-for-Industry-and-commerce-GENPRO-LB-EU8-12K-100x100.webp 100w\" sizes=\"auto, (max-width: 472px) 100vw, 472px\" \/><\/p>\n<p><span style=\"font-weight: 400;\">Un inversor es un dispositivo que convierte corriente continua (CC) en corriente alterna (CA). Los inversores se utilizan en muchos m\u00e1s sistemas que solo los solares; varias otras tecnolog\u00edas tambi\u00e9n los emplean. Por ejemplo:<\/span><\/p>\n<p>&nbsp;<\/p>\n<ul>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Sistemas de energ\u00eda solar<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Energ\u00eda de respaldo para el hogar<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Autocaravanas y furgonetas camper<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">barcos<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Caba\u00f1as aisladas de la red el\u00e9ctrica<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Sistemas de energ\u00eda de emergencia<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">estaciones de trabajo m\u00f3viles<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Equipos industriales<\/span><\/li>\n<\/ul>\n<p>&nbsp;<\/p>\n<h2><span style=\"font-weight: 400;\">\u00bfQu\u00e9 es un inversor de onda sinusoidal pura?<\/span><\/h2>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Un inversor de onda sinusoidal pura produce una forma de onda continua que coincide con la de la red el\u00e9ctrica. Suele ser la forma de onda m\u00e1s segura para distintos tipos de electrodom\u00e9sticos y ofrece un suministro de energ\u00eda de alta calidad.<\/span><\/p>\n<p>&nbsp;<\/p>\n<h3><b>Caracter\u00edsticas de los inversores de onda sinusoidal pura<\/b><\/h3>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Los inversores de onda sinusoidal pura presentan diferentes caracter\u00edsticas. A continuaci\u00f3n, se muestra la lista de caracter\u00edsticas.<\/span><\/p>\n<p>&nbsp;<\/p>\n<ul>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">forma de onda de CA suave<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Distorsi\u00f3n arm\u00f3nica baja<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Salida de voltaje estable<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Funcionamiento silencioso del aparato<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Alta compatibilidad<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Rendimiento eficiente del motor<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Adecuado para dispositivos electr\u00f3nicos sensibles.<\/span><\/li>\n<\/ul>\n<p>&nbsp;<\/p>\n<h2><span style=\"font-weight: 400;\">\u00bfQu\u00e9 es un inversor de onda sinusoidal modificada?<\/span><\/h2>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Un inversor de onda sinusoidal modificada funciona de manera diferente y produce una forma de onda de salida distinta, con un patr\u00f3n escalonado o cuadrado, a diferencia de la salida de onda sinusoidal suave.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">El dise\u00f1o parece m\u00e1s sencillo y eficiente, pero no es adecuado para todos los electrodom\u00e9sticos que utilizas.<\/span><\/p>\n<p>&nbsp;<\/p>\n<h3><b>Caracter\u00edsticas principales del inversor de onda sinusoidal modificada\u00a0<\/b><\/h3>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Un inversor de onda sinusoidal modificada tiene varias caracter\u00edsticas, tales como:<\/span><\/p>\n<p>&nbsp;<\/p>\n<ul>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">forma de onda escalonada<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Menor coste de fabricaci\u00f3n<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Electr\u00f3nica m\u00e1s sencilla<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Compatibilidad reducida<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Aumento del ruido el\u00e9ctrico<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Menor eficiencia para algunos dispositivos.<\/span><\/li>\n<\/ul>\n<p>&nbsp;<\/p>\n<h2><span style=\"font-weight: 400;\">Inversor de onda sinusoidal pura frente a inversor de onda sinusoidal modificada: la comparaci\u00f3n definitiva\u00a0<\/span><\/h2>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Es hora de comprender c\u00f3mo se diferencian ambas formas de onda. Aqu\u00ed est\u00e1 la lista de diferencias.<\/span><\/p>\n<p>&nbsp;<\/p>\n<table>\n<tbody>\n<tr>\n<td><b>Caracter\u00edstica<\/b><\/td>\n<td><b>Onda sinusoidal pura<\/b><\/td>\n<td><b>Onda sinusoidal modificada<\/b><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400;\">forma de onda de salida<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Liso<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Escalonado<\/span><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400;\">Similar a la energ\u00eda el\u00e9ctrica<\/span><\/td>\n<td><span style=\"font-weight: 400;\">S\u00ed<\/span><\/td>\n<td><span style=\"font-weight: 400;\">No<\/span><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400;\">Compatibilidad del aparato<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Excelente<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Limitado<\/span><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400;\">Rendimiento del motor<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Liso<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Menos eficiente<\/span><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400;\">Ruido<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Muy tranquilo<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Puede producir zumbidos<\/span><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400;\">Eficacia<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Mayor en general<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Menor para muchas cargas<\/span><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400;\">Electr\u00f3nica sensible<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Seguro<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Puede causar problemas<\/span><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400;\">Coste<\/span><\/td>\n<td><span style=\"font-weight: 400;\">M\u00e1s alto<\/span><\/td>\n<td><span style=\"font-weight: 400;\">M\u00e1s bajo<\/span><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400;\">utilizaci\u00f3n de la bater\u00eda<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Mejor<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Menos eficiente<\/span><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400;\">Lo mejor para<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Viviendas, sistemas solares, equipos m\u00e9dicos<\/span><\/td>\n<td><span style=\"font-weight: 400;\">Electrodom\u00e9sticos b\u00e1sicos y herramientas sencillas<\/span><\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<p>&nbsp;<\/p>\n<h3><b>forma de onda de salida<\/b><\/h3>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">La forma de onda es la principal diferencia. Los inversores de onda sinusoidal pura ofrecen una salida suave y uniforme. En cambio, los inversores de onda sinusoidal modificada presentan una forma de onda escalonada que puede provocar una ca\u00edda de tensi\u00f3n.<\/span><\/p>\n<p>&nbsp;<\/p>\n<h3><b>Similar a la energ\u00eda el\u00e9ctrica<\/b><\/h3>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">La forma de onda determina si es compatible y similar a la de la red el\u00e9ctrica.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Los inversores de onda sinusoidal pura ofrecen similitudes con la energ\u00eda el\u00e9ctrica convencional debido a su suministro de energ\u00eda suave y de alta calidad.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Los inversores de onda sinusoidal modificada son diferentes de la energ\u00eda de la red el\u00e9ctrica.<\/span><\/p>\n<p>&nbsp;<\/p>\n<h3><b>Compatibilidad del aparato<\/b><\/h3>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">La compatibilidad de los electrodom\u00e9sticos a menudo depende de un funcionamiento seguro.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Los inversores de onda sinusoidal pura ofrecen una mejor compatibilidad tanto para electrodom\u00e9sticos sensibles como para los que no lo son.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Por otro lado, los inversores de onda sinusoidal modificada solo son adecuados para un n\u00famero limitado de aparatos que ni siquiera son seguros.<\/span><\/p>\n<p>&nbsp;<\/p>\n<h3><b>Rendimiento del motor<\/b><\/h3>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">El rendimiento del motor var\u00eda en funci\u00f3n de la forma de onda.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Los inversores de onda sinusoidal pura ofrecen un mejor soporte para el funcionamiento de los motores y proporcionan una alta eficiencia.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Por otro lado, los inversores de onda sinusoidal modificada no ofrecen una eficiencia tan alta como los inversores de onda sinusoidal pura.<\/span><\/p>\n<p>&nbsp;<\/p>\n<h3><b>Ruido<\/b><\/h3>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">\u00bfQu\u00e9 es lo que m\u00e1s te gusta? No te preocupes si tienes el tipo adecuado.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Por ejemplo, los inversores de onda sinusoidal pura ya son la mejor opci\u00f3n para aparatos sensibles. Ofrecen una forma de onda suave y mayor seguridad.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Por otro lado, los inversores de onda sinusoidal modificada pueden provocar interrupciones y da\u00f1ar aparatos sensibles debido a los cambios de voltaje.<\/span><\/p>\n<p>&nbsp;<\/p>\n<h3><b>Coste<\/b><\/h3>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Si te preguntas sobre la asequibilidad, veamos cu\u00e1l es la mejor opci\u00f3n aqu\u00ed.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Los inversores de onda sinusoidal pura son m\u00e1s caros debido a su mayor eficiencia, seguridad y funcionamiento m\u00e1s suave.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">En cambio, los inversores de onda sinusoidal modificada no son tan buenos. Por lo tanto, son m\u00e1s econ\u00f3micos pero menos seguros.<\/span><\/p>\n<h3><b>utilizaci\u00f3n de la bater\u00eda<\/b><\/h3>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Las bater\u00edas son componentes cruciales de la instalaci\u00f3n solar. Los inversores ayudan a consumir la energ\u00eda de las bater\u00edas.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Los inversores de onda sinusoidal pura ofrecen una mejor y m\u00e1s eficiente utilizaci\u00f3n de la bater\u00eda. Proporcionan un mejor suministro de energ\u00eda.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Por otro lado, los inversores de onda sinusoidal modificada no tienen una mayor eficiencia debido al patr\u00f3n escalonado.<\/span><\/p>\n<p>&nbsp;<\/p>\n<h2><span style=\"font-weight: 400;\">\u00bfCu\u00e1l deber\u00edas elegir?<\/span><\/h2>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">\u00bfTienes dudas sobre la selecci\u00f3n? No te preocupes; te lo hemos puesto a\u00fan m\u00e1s f\u00e1cil con las siguientes recomendaciones para tus soluciones de inversores.\u00a0<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Elija un inversor de onda sinusoidal pura en los siguientes casos.<\/span><\/p>\n<p>&nbsp;<\/p>\n<ul>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Refrigeradores o congeladores el\u00e9ctricos<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Utilice ordenadores o equipos de red.<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Manejar dispositivos m\u00e9dicos<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Tener un sistema de bater\u00edas solares<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Hacer funcionar aparatos con motores el\u00e9ctricos<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">\u00bfDesea la m\u00e1xima vida \u00fatil de sus electrodom\u00e9sticos?<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Necesitamos electricidad de calidad profesional.<\/span><\/li>\n<\/ul>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">En los siguientes casos, deber\u00eda optar por un inversor de onda sinusoidal modificada.<\/span><\/p>\n<p>&nbsp;<\/p>\n<ul>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Tener un presupuesto limitado<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Alimentaci\u00f3n \u00fanicamente para iluminaci\u00f3n b\u00e1sica y cargadores.<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Necesita energ\u00eda de respaldo temporal u ocasional.<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Utilice cargas resistivas b\u00e1sicas sin componentes electr\u00f3nicos sensibles.<\/span><\/li>\n<\/ul>\n<p>&nbsp;<\/p>\n<h2><span style=\"font-weight: 400;\">Conclusi\u00f3n\u00a0<\/span><\/h2>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Ambos tipos de inversores ofrecen una producci\u00f3n de energ\u00eda de calidad y garantizan un rendimiento estable, salvo en contadas excepciones. Los inversores de onda sinusoidal modificada son una opci\u00f3n ideal para sistemas econ\u00f3micos con aparatos que no requieren alta sensibilidad. Sin embargo, un inversor de onda sinusoidal pura ofrece compatibilidad con energ\u00eda de alta calidad para aplicaciones sensibles.<\/span><\/p>\n<p>&nbsp;<\/p>\n<p><span style=\"font-weight: 400;\">Al elegir el tipo adecuado, debe centrarse en varios factores clave.
